About this role:

Wells Fargo is seeking a Change Implementation Coordinator to join our Experienced Advisor Onboarding team as part of Wealth & Investment Management. Learn more about the career areas and lines of business at wellsfargojobs.com.

Experienced Advisor Onboarding is a team that centrally manages direct support for account opening and asset transfer activities as well as providing training and guidance to all levels of brokerage industry associates. The team provides direct support to Wells Fargo Advisors (WFA) business channels: Private Client Group [PCG], Wealth Brokerage Services [WBS], Wells Fargo Financial Network and First Clearing.

In this role, you will:

  • Support newly hired experienced advisors and their teams by transitioning their book of business and providing support and training during the transition period

  • Generate and distribute transition metrics for supported advisors

  • Support the efforts of the team by participating in calls with advisors to review the process and procedures 

  • Support change implementation by identifying ways to improve workflow and offer recommendations and support for the team

  • Serve as a point of coordination for clients throughout the customer life cycle, providing operational and training support as needed

  • Ensure customer implementation data is accurately captured and recorded

  • Communicate product dependencies and support the timeline for implementation

  • Perform complex administrative and operational support tasks

  • Provide maintenance support for project teams and assist in determining implementation strategy

  • Receive direction from manager and escalate non-routine questions

  • Interact with peers, management, and technology on implementation of strategy, methods, and plans for initiatives that impact workflow
